About DL16 6SA: area rating, property, schools and local change

DL16 6SA is a postcode in Tudhoe, County Durham, North East, England. This postcode area guide brings together crime, schools, demographics, property prices, planning applications, HMO licences and roadworks near DL16 6SA, then scores the surrounding small area 66/100 - top 26% nationally across 8 matched LocaleIQ domains.

The strongest signals around DL16 6SA are local prosperity and health, while schools and education is the main area to examine before moving, renting or buying here. LocaleIQ uses these local signals as a practical area rating rather than a single raw statistic, so read the score alongside the detailed map layers and source records.

The demographic profile for DL16 6SA is based on County Durham 047 Census 2021. It covers 6,687 residents, 998 people per square kilometre. The median age is around 50, helping show whether the area skews younger, family-sized or older. Housing tenure is 73% owner-occupied, 12% privately rented, 16% social rented, useful context for renters, buyers and landlords comparing the local property market. On the official England neighbourhood wellbeing index the area ranks in decile 9/10.

For property prices near DL16 6SA, LocaleIQ uses Land Registry sold-price evidence for the DL16 postcode district. The latest median sold price is £125k from 125 rolling sales, up 8.7% month-on-month. The Property tab separates flats, terraced, semi-detached and detached homes where enough sales exist.

Families checking schools near DL16 6SA can compare 9 state schools within one mile, including 8 rated Good or Outstanding by Ofsted or the equivalent inspectorate. The Schools tab adds phase, school type, distance, rating and a dedicated school map so the education context is easier to judge.
